Understanding the eClinicalWorks Ecosystem for Referrals

To fully grasp the power of automating referral scheduling, it’s essential to understand the core components of eClinicalWorks that make this possible. The platform is built on several interconnected modules, each contributing to a fluid workflow:

1. Electronic Health Records (EHR)

This is the heart of eClinicalWorks. Within the EHR, providers document patient encounters, diagnoses, and treatment plans. When a referral is indicated, the provider can electronically flag this need within the patient’s chart. This action serves as the trigger for the automated referral process. ECW’s EHR supports detailed clinical documentation, including SOAP notes and specialty-specific templates, ensuring that all necessary clinical information for the referral is captured accurately and efficiently.

2. Practice Management (PM)

The Practice Management module handles the operational workflows of a clinic, including appointment scheduling, patient registration, and front-office tasks. When the EHR flags a referral, the PM system can utilize this information to search for available specialists within the practice’s network or designated referral partners. This module is key to linking the clinical need for a referral with the administrative task of booking an appointment.

3. Patient Engagement (healow Ecosystem)

The healow ecosystem is a significant differentiator for eClinicalWorks, focusing on patient-facing tools. This includes the patient portal and mobile app. For automated referral scheduling, the healow portal can play a vital role. Once a referral is initiated in the EHR, the system can prompt the patient via the portal to select a specialist or schedule an appointment based on available slots. This empowers patients to take an active role in their care coordination.

4. Interoperability & Data Exchange

For referrals to specialists outside the immediate practice network, interoperability is key. eClinicalWorks facilitates data exchange through features like the eEHX (health information exchange) and its P2P network. This allows for the secure transmission of patient records and referral information to external providers, ensuring continuity of care.

The Automated Referral Scheduling Workflow

The automation of referral scheduling after chart creation in eClinicalWorks typically follows a logical, integrated sequence:

  1. Provider Documentation: During or immediately after a patient visit, the provider documents the need for a referral within the EHR. This might involve selecting a referral reason from a dropdown menu or adding specific notes. Crucially, the provider can designate the referral type (e.g., to a cardiologist, a physical therapist) and may even select a preferred specialist or facility.

2. System Trigger: Once the provider finalizes the encounter or a specific referral order within the EHR, the system automatically triggers the referral workflow. This eliminates the need for the provider or administrative staff to manually initiate the process.

3. Referral Information Transmission: The system gathers all pertinent clinical information from the patient’s chart—including demographics, medical history, current condition, and the reason for referral—and compiles it into a referral packet. This packet can then be securely transmitted to the chosen specialist’s office. eClinicalWorks supports various transmission methods, including secure fax, direct EHR-to-EHR messaging, or through a secure patient portal for the specialist.

4. Specialist Coordination & Scheduling: This is where automation truly shines. Depending on the configured workflow, the system can:

Proactively Schedule: If the practice has direct scheduling agreements with the specialist, eClinicalWorks can query the specialist’s scheduling system for available appointments that match the patient’s needs and the provider’s urgency. The system can then propose appointment slots to the patient or automatically book the earliest available slot.  Facilitate Patient Scheduling: Alternatively, the system can notify the patient via the healow portal or a secure message that a referral has been made. The patient is then prompted to log into their healow account to view available appointment times with the referred specialist and select a convenient slot. This empowers patients and reduces the administrative burden on the clinic. * Automated Follow-Up: The system can be configured to automatically follow up with the specialist’s office if a response or confirmation is not received within a specified timeframe, ensuring that referrals don’t fall through the cracks.

5. Confirmation and Integration: Once an appointment is scheduled, whether automatically by the system or selected by the patient, the appointment details are automatically updated in both the referring practice’s PM system and the specialist’s system (if integrated). The patient also receives confirmation via their preferred communication channel (email, SMS, or portal notification).

Key Features Enabling Automation in eClinicalWorks

Several key features within eClinicalWorks empower this automated referral scheduling process:

  • Integrated EHR and PM: The seamless connection between clinical documentation and scheduling is fundamental.
  • Smart Templates and Order Sets: Providers can pre-configure referral orders within templates, ensuring all necessary fields are populated quickly.
  • e-Referral Functionality: eClinicalWorks offers built-in tools for electronic referral generation and transmission.
  • healow Patient Portal and App: This provides the patient-facing interface for appointment selection and communication.
  • eClinicalMessenger and healow Genie: These tools facilitate automated patient communication, including appointment confirmations, reminders, and follow-ups.
  • AI and Automation Layer: Newer capabilities, like PRISMA (clinical search engine) and virtual assistants, can further streamline data retrieval and communication tasks related to referrals.

Challenges and Considerations

While the benefits are substantial, implementing automated referral scheduling requires careful planning and execution. Some potential challenges include:

  • Workflow Customization: Practices need to define and configure their specific referral workflows within eClinicalWorks, which may require dedicated IT or administrative effort.
  • Specialist Integration: The degree of automation often depends on the technological capabilities and willingness of the referred specialists to integrate with eClinicalWorks’ systems. Not all external practices may have compatible EHRs or be open to electronic data exchange.
  • Patient Adoption: The success of patient-initiated scheduling through the healow portal relies on patient engagement and digital literacy. Practices may need to invest in patient education and support.
  • Data Accuracy: The system relies on accurate and up-to-date information regarding provider availability, specialist networks, and insurance.
  • Training: Staff and providers will need training on the new automated workflows to ensure smooth adoption.

Can eClinicalWorks automate scheduling with any specialist?

The extent of automation with external specialists depends on their practice's technological capabilities and willingness to integrate. eClinicalWorks can electronically send referral information to many specialists, but direct, real-time scheduling may require specific integrations or agreements with those external practices.
